Some of the Barnes family can be seen in the registers of Madron, Paul, Gulval and Ludgvan.


Newlyn is famous for its painters - one being Stanhope Forbes who immortilised my great-grandmother's son, Walter Barnes, in a portrait (oils on canvass) as they were very good friends and shared a love of music.

In 1931, at Penzance Walter Barnes - Pen Ylow (Chief of Music) - was made a Bard of the Cornish Gorseth for services to music in Cornwall.
